IN NO EVENT SHALL THE AUTHORS OR COPYRIGHT + * HOLDERS BE LIABLE FOR ANY CLAIM, DAMAGES OR OTHER LIABILITY, + * WHETHER IN AN ACTION OF CONTRACT, TORT OR OTHERWISE, ARISING + * FROM, OUT OF OR IN CONNECTION WITH THE SOFTWARE OR THE USE OR + * OTHER DEALINGS IN THE SOFTWARE. + */ + +/** @mainpage + * + * <div style="margin: 2em 5em 2em 5em; border: 1px solid #CCC; padding: 1em; background: #E8EEF2;"> + * Various specifications specify files and file formats. The <a + * href="http://standards.freedesktop.org/basedir-spec/basedir-spec-0.6.html"> + * XDG Base Directory specification</a> defines where these files should + * be looked for by defining one or more base directories relative to + * which files should be located. + * </div> + * + * This library implements functions to list the directories according + * to the specification and provides a few higher-level functions for + * use with the specification. + */ + +/** @file basedir.h + * Functions for using the XDG Base Directory specification. */ + +#ifndef XDG_BASEDIR_H +#define XDG_BASEDIR_H + +#ifdef __cplusplus +extern "C" { +#endif + +/** Version of XDG Base Directory specification implemented in this library. */ +#define XDG_BASEDIR_SPEC 0.6 + +/** @name XDG data cache management */ +/*@{*/ + +/** Handle to XDG data cache. + * Handles are initialized with xdgInitHandle() and + * freed with xdgWipeHandle(). */ +typedef struct /*_xdgHandle*/ { + /** Reserved for internal use, do not modify. */ + void *reserved; +} xdgHandle; + +/** Initialize a handle to an XDG data cache and initialize the cache. + * Use xdgWipeHandle() to free the handle. + * @return a pointer to the handle if initialization was successful, else 0 */ +xdgHandle * xdgInitHandle(xdgHandle *handle); + +/** Wipe handle of XDG data cache. + * Wipe handle initialized using xdgInitHandle(). */ +void xdgWipeHandle(xdgHandle *handle); + +/** Update the data cache. + * This should not be done frequently as it reallocates the cache. + * Even if updating the cache fails the handle remains valid and can + * be used to access XDG data as it was before xdgUpdateData() was called. + * @return 0 if update failed, non-0 if successful.*/ +int xdgUpdateData(xdgHandle *handle); + +/*@}*/ +/** @name Basic XDG Base Directory Queries */ +/*@{*/ + +/** Base directory for user specific data files. + * @param handle Handle to data cache, initialized with xdgInitHandle(). + * @return a path as described by the standards. */ +const char * xdgDataHome(xdgHandle *handle); + +/** Base directory for user specific configuration files. + * @param handle Handle to data cache, initialized with xdgInitHandle(). + * @return a path as described by the standards. */ +const char * xdgConfigHome(xdgHandle *handle); + +/** Preference-ordered set of base directories to search for data files + * in addition to the $XDG_DATA_HOME base directory. + * @param handle Handle to data cache, initialized with xdgInitHandle(). + * @return A null-terminated list of directory strings. */ +const char * const * xdgDataDirectories(xdgHandle *handle); + +/** Preference-ordered set of base directories to search for data files + * with $XDG_DATA_HOME prepended. + * The base directory defined by $XDG_DATA_HOME is considered more + * important than any of the base directories defined by $XDG_DATA_DIRS. + * @param handle Handle to data cache, initialized with xdgInitHandle(). + * @return A null-terminated list of directory strings. */ +const char * const * xdgSearchableDataDirectories(xdgHandle *handle); + +/** Preference-ordered set of base directories to search for configuration + * files in addition to the $XDG_CONFIG_HOME base directory. + * @param handle Handle to data cache, initialized with xdgInitHandle(). + * @return A null-terminated list of directory strings. */ +const char * const * xdgConfigDirectories(xdgHandle *handle); + +/** Preference-ordered set of base directories to search for configuration + * files with $XDG_CONFIG_HOME prepended. + * The base directory defined by $XDG_CONFIG_HOME is considered more + * important than any of the base directories defined by $XDG_CONFIG_DIRS. + * @param handle Handle to data cache, initialized with xdgInitHandle(). + * @return A null-terminated list of directory strings. */ +const char * const * xdgSearchableConfigDirectories(xdgHandle *handle); + +/** Base directory for user specific non-essential data files. + * @param handle Handle to data cache, initialized with xdgInitHandle(). + * @return a path as described by the standards. */ +const char * xdgCacheHome(xdgHandle *handle); + +/*@}*/ + +#ifdef __cplusplus +} // extern "C" +#endif + +#endif /*XDG_BASEDIR_H*/ |
